Web Developer Salary in India – For Freshers & Experienced

web developer salary

Do you enjoy what goes behind a website? 

Do you wonder how these excellent developments are working?

If yes, you might have taken the right start in web development. But the constant struggle is with the in-depth knowledge of the profession and what is in there for you. 

Confused about your next job?

In 4 simple steps you can find your personalised career roadmap in Software development for FREE

Expand in New Tab 

Then this post is for you. From the start till the end, all it talks about is web development, what does a web developer do?; what are the skills required for a web developer?; how much is the salary of a web developer in India?; What are the responsibilities like? And so many bunches of questions like these. 

This article will answer all your why’s and what’s of web development and a web developer. 

Introduction to Web Development

The Internet has remained a miraculous space since the 1990s. While many enjoyed the benefits of it and used it for their advantage. Some have a keen interest to know every reason and logic behind the working of this amazing Internet. 

What caught their attention was how a static page could deliver infinite solutions; or the fact that by clicking a button, they are taken to another webpage that serves some other purpose. There was an absolute curiosity to learn about the visual aspect of a website to its functions and modifications. 

Succeeding that passion and interest was the beginning of web development. 

Website development is a comprehensive process of building a complete website. It could incorporate from working on a plain-text single webpage to developing a full-fledged website for the Internet. This applies to all the work related to:

  • Web Markup
  • Client-side scripting (Front-end work)
  • Server-side scripting (Back-end work)
  • Server and Network Security Configuration
  • E-commerce development
  • Content Management System (CMS) development.

Web development is not just designing a website, it’s a whole process of bringing it to life and maintaining it.

Web Developer Salary in India

Salary speaks what your words and actions cannot. The role and responsibility of a web developer begin with designing and ends with smooth execution and maintaining of a website. Hence, the range of the salary will be according to the knowledge and skills a developer possesses. 

The average salary for a Web Developer is ranging from the minimum of ₹125,000 to a maximum of ₹890,000

average salary of web developer in inda

However, the range of this salary depends upon many factors ranging from experience to the employer to your location. 


Who is a Web Developer?

A web developer is a programmer who creates and maintains a website. 

Looking at this statement, the job looks so simplified. However, just like any lucrative, easy-looking website goes through a complex process of working, the same is the working of any web developer. 

A web developer gives shape to a client’s design, turning his/her idea into a functional website or an application. 

What do they do?

Now you must be wondering, how is a web developer’s job different from the job of a web designer? 

What does a front-end developer do then? 

Does a web developer have to do everything? 

First, you need to take a deep breath. 

Second, you need to understand there are different types of developers. In addition to this, there is a clear differentiation between a web developer and a designer. The distinct remarkability amongst all these roles is necessary to understand in order to get a more precise idea of the web developer’s salary. 

Web development has a wide scope of work and it proffers different areas for web developers to work on. Some of those professions include:

  1. Front-end Developer: The significant responsibility of a front-end developer lies in the client’s side of websites, that is, what the users can see. They ensure an interactive-facing side of the website for a better user experience. The three central components a good developer uses are HTML, CSS, and JavaScript. 

  2. Back-end Developer: A perfect film is not just about the on-screen acting. It takes into account all the effort put in by the behind-the-scenes team. Similarly, for a website to work with a smooth transition on the server, one needs a back-end developer. They manage all the coding for site structure, content and security. 

  3. Full-stack developers: Unlike the above-mentioned developers, full-stack developers does not specialize in one area of development, rather have an all-around knowledge of different technologies to supervise different areas of a website. They work on the surface as well as on the server. 

Following this, the question remains if a front-end developer could visualize the look of the website, what is the need for a web designer?

A web designer works on the visuals/graphics of the website to engage and attract the user using creative tools like Adobe, Photoshop etc.  

A front-end developer will work on building the interface for the design of the website to function using coding languages like CSS, HTML, JavaScript.  

What is alike: Both Focuses on the user/customer experience. 

What is different: The idea that one completely relies on the appearance of the surface while the other achieves the way function of each appeared element. 

One takes the graphic side of the website while the other handles the code. 

Web Developers Job Role and Responsibilities

As it is clear from the above that a web developer’s salary in India will be based on her/his knowledge of complete designing to execution of a perfect website or web application. 

Some of the responsibilities expected from a web developer are:

  • Website application designing, building, or maintaining.
  • Create website layout/user interface by using standard HTML/CSS practices
  • In situations of conflicts, dwell on the idea of clear communication with your team for quick resolution and hassle-free working. 
  • Be responsible for maintaining, expanding, and scaling the website.
  • Cooperate with web designers to match visual design intent
  • Keeping yourself under the complete knowledge of the latest updates and modifications in the field of Web Development via attending conferences, workshops; participating in discussions; studying or reading about innovations.
  • Checking and validating your test cases and routines in order to ensure the smooth running of codes on all browsers and devices types.
  • Always look out for customer feedback and work on the problems and resolutions necessary for achieving significant results. 
  • Stay plugged into emerging technologies/industry trends for determining user needs
  • Make a reserve of website backup files to local directories for emergency recoveries. 

Is being a web developer hard? 

Nothing is hard if you have true passion and interest. 

However, the web developer does not simply equate to writing just lines of codes. It is much more than the basic requirement of learning a coding language. One has to be analytical, yet have clear communication with the team. 

For this pivotal role to make you understand the clear skillset, we have divided it into two categories. 

Hard Skills

  • HTML
  • CSS
  • JavaScript
  • Tools
  • Debugging
  • GIT (Code Versioning)
  • Basic graphic design
  • Back end and Databases
  • Working with Hosting (Publishing website)
  • Libraries and frameworks
  • DevOps and Deployment

Soft Skills

  • Problem-solving Skills
  • Logical Reasoning
  • Good Communication
  • Patience
  • Attention to Detail
  • Curiosity to Learn
  • Searching Skills
  • Time Management

Both of the skillset are equally important to become a good web developer.

Is Web Developer a good career?

The time that we live in besides being called a Postmodern era can be replaced by the Digital Era. People have deconstructed its application and taken the space of the internet to another level. 

Every business, every individual, everything in this digital era needs a website. Starting from a product to a service and even a personal brand requires an online presence and that is possible with a website or a web application. 

This unquestionably states the inevitable boom of the web development profession. One just needs the right set of skillsets and learning and the passion to stand out from the rest. As every day, the horizon of a web developer’s career is expanding and escalating. 

The trends and the technologies behold a spectacular and booming future ahead.

  • Single Page Websites
  • Accelerated Mobile Pages (AMP)
  • Progressive Web Apps (PWA)
  • Integrating Solutions With Artificial Intelligence
  • Chatbots Offering A New Experience
  • Internet of Things (IoT)
  • WebAssembly Making Web Apps Powerful
  • Serverless Architecture
  • Push Notifications Are Getting Popular
  • Blockchain Technology
  • AR/VR Changing Games For All
  • Movement User Interface (UI) Design
  • Web Server Software 

Web Developer Salary Deciding Factors

There are numerous factors besides the job’s demand and position in the country that comes into play while deciding the final salary. 

Some of the factors that hugely affect a web developer’s salary are:

  • Experience: There is no question of doubt in saying that a salary will depend on the years of a developer’s job experience. A fresher in the field might have the talent but an experienced person might know how to handle the situation better because of the experience. 
  • Location: Urban locations certainly have a higher pay scale than rural locations as the cost of living comes into play.
  • Employer: The company you are entering will surely affect your salary structure as a startup would be willing for more freshers whereas big, reputed employers are willing to pay more because of their position in the market and their financial standing. 
  • Skillset: More the skills, the better. Especially when a role is as diversified as a web developer every company has their own set of required skillset. So, the number of skills you put a tick on the more likely the higher pay you can get. 
  • Job Roles: We have discussed the different job roles a web developer could be, and hence based on their demand in the country will be one of the deciding factors of your pay structure.

1. Web Developer Salary in India: Based On Experience

Look at the graphs and stats of the web developer’s salary for fresher, early-level career and mid-level careers. 

Web Developer’s Salary for Fresher

An entry-level Web Developer with less than 1-year experience can expect to earn an average total compensation (includes tips, bonus, and overtime pay) of ₹241,239

web developer salary for fresher
Graph of web developer salary for fresher

Source: PayScale

Early Level Web Developer Salary in India

An early career Web Developer with 1-4 years of experience earns an average total compensation of ₹305,745

early level web developer salary in india
early level web developer salary graph

Source: PayScale

Experienced Web Developer Salary in India

An experienced Web Developer with 10-19 years of experience earns an average total compensation of ₹850,000

experienced web developer salary in india
experienced web developer salary graph

Source: PayScale

2. Web Developer Salary in India: Based On Location

Web Developer Salary in Bangalore

The average salary for a Web Developer in Bangalore is ₹398K per year.

web developer salary in bangalore

Web Developer Salary in Mumbai, Maharashtra

The average salary for a Web Developer in Mumbai is ₹339K per year.

web developer salary in mumbai

Web Developer Salary in Pune

The average salary for a Web Developer in Pune, Maharashtra is ₹307K per year.

web developer salary in pune

Web Developer Salary in Chennai, Tamil Nadu

The average salary for a Web Developer in Chennai  is ₹314K per year.

web developer salary in chennai

Web Developer Salary in New Delhi

The average salary for a Web Developer in the capital region is ₹350K per year.

web developer salary in new delhi

Source: PayScale

3. Web Developer Salary in India: Based On Employer

Many companies in the technical field pays a great amount to web developers in India. The more interesting fact is that even the lowest average pay amongst below mentioned top employers is 245K/year which is not bad pay for a fresher.

The Top Employers and their average salary for a web developer are: 

Employer NameAverage Pay Range
TATA Consultancy Services Limited₹239k – ₹897k/yr
Cognizant₹245k – ₹2m/yr
Accenture₹266k – ₹979k/yr
Infosys Limited₹354k – ₹590k/yr
Zoho Corporation₹600k – ₹745k/yr
Amazon Inc.₹403k – ₹2m/yr
Sapient Corporation₹983k/yr
HCL Technologies₹311k-1m/yr


4. Web Developer Salary in India: Based On Skill Set

Every developer be it full-stack, front-end, or back-end requires a set of skills. It’s not always about several skills you know but a SKILL you know. If you think learning HTML earlier used to suffice, then obviously your pay would be based on that only.  A web developer’s salary in India is highly based on the proficiency you have in your skills and your willingness to adapt to new skills.

web developer salary based on skillset

According to this, if a developer is skilled in JavaScript, his/her pay will be above average. Whereas skills like Cascading Style Sheets (CSS), HTML5, and PHP will pay less than the market rate of a web developer. 

Source: PayScale

5. Web Developer Salary in India: Based On Job Positions

A Web Developer has so many career options to explore and the salary will be varied depending on the role you choose. 

Job Positions and The Salary 

  1. Front-End Developer

The average salary for a Front End Developer / Engineer is ₹487,802

average salary of front end developer

2. Back-End Developer

The average salary for a Back End Developer / Engineer is ₹393, 054

average salary of back end developer

3. Full-Stack Developer

The average salary for a Full Stack Developer / Engineer is ₹607,012

average salary of full stack developer

Web Developer’s Salary in India for a full-stack developer is equated to be the highest paid jobs in India. 

Source: PayScale

Web Developer Salary in Other Countries

Check out the list of average web developer’s salaries in different countries. 

CountrySalary (USD)
United States$50,900.00
United Kingdom$36,875.00



If visualizing and creating a website is your passion, this is the right call for you. Web Development is a booming field with immersive career opportunities and a great pay scale structure.


Q.1: Do Web developers get paid well?

A web developer’s salary like any other profession will be based on many factors. Starting from location, a web developer’s salary in India will be an average upon as 300k/yr. 

However, if you are a fresher in Australia, your income would be on the average of 2.9m/yr. The difference is huge. 

But location is not always the deciding factor. A developer can be eligible for so many job roles, one being a Full-stack developer. This job position is considered to be one of the highest-paid jobs in India. 

Q.2: How much money can a Web Developer earn?

A web developer has the potential to grow in so many sectors. From a range of experience to acquiring varied skills, the pay scale also starts to differ. In India, a web developer’s salary for a fresher is approximately a minimum of ₹125,000 while that of an experienced developer’s salary is approximately ₹890,000. 

So, a web developer has quite an earning escalation to look up to.

Q.3: Is being a web developer hard?

Everything is hard if you don’t have the passion or the curiosity to learn in your field. Likewise, a web developer’s job comes with defined roles and responsibilities and, if you are willing to grow and explore this field with sincere passion, then this will be rather a productive opportunity for you.

Q.4: What is the minimum salary of a web developer?

In India, the minimum salary of a web developer as a fresher is approximately ₹300,000/yr. This could vary in terms of location, skillset and job role. 

Q.5: Can Web developers work from home?

Yes, web developers can work from home. After covid, every job aspirant wishes for a profession that could be suitable for work from home option. 

Web Developer in itself is quite a desired profession and its being suitable for the work-from-home option is like a cherry on the top. It allows for more freelancing opportunities for aspiring coders with no professional degrees.

Additional Resources

Previous Post
WordPress Books

10 Best WordPress Books [2023]

Next Post
front end developer salary

Front End Developer Salary in India – For Freshers & Experienced